Carson Hocevar Secures Long-Term Deal with Spire Motorsports

Spire Motorsports announced on Thursday a long-term contract extension with Carson Hocevar that ensures the 23-year-old driver will remain in the No. 77 Chevrolet through at least the next four NASCAR Cup Series seasons. This extension solidifies Hocevar’s future with the team well into the upcoming decade, reflecting his rising status within the sport and the organization.

Though specific financial terms of the contract have not been disclosed, this extension underlines the team’s confidence in Hocevar following his 2024 NASCAR Cup Series rookie of the year campaign.

Hocevar’s Progress and Performance Highlights

A native of Michigan, Hocevar first claimed a Cup Series pole position last year and finished the season with nine top-10 finishes, including two runner-up results. Despite concluding 23rd in the overall standings, his performance often demonstrated more potential than his final ranking suggests.

Before joining the Cup Series, Hocevar competed full-time in the Truck Series with Niece Motorsports, where he amassed five wins and 34 top-10 finishes across 81 starts. His consistency earned him playoff appearances in each of his three full-time seasons, with a notable run to the championship round in 2023.

Team Ownership and Strategic Growth

Spire Motorsports is now majority owned by TWG Motorsports, an organization that also owns several other high-profile racing teams including Andretti Global in IndyCar, Wayne Taylor Racing in IMSA, and the Cadillac Formula 1 team debuting this season. TWG’s parent company also holds ownership stakes in the Los Angeles Lakers and Los Angeles Dodgers, showing its expansive presence across major sports.

Leadership Perspective on Hocevar’s Role

Jeff Dickerson, co-owner of Spire Motorsports, emphasized the significance of securing Hocevar’s presence for multiple seasons.

ā€œIt’s a pretty big moment for our company to announce an extension with Carson that takes us out for multiple years,ā€

said Dickerson.

ā€œIt’s not just about knowing he’ll be here with us for the long-haul, but it gives our sponsors and competition group the foresight to make their own plans knowing he’s in the seat of the No. 77 as far as we can see.ā€

Dickerson also reflected on the personal and professional growth he has witnessed in Hocevar, acknowledging the challenges and rewards of developing the young driver.

ā€œIt has been an absolutely rewarding experience getting to know Carson and watching him grow up, and learn from the good and bad both at and away from the racetrack,ā€

Dickerson added.

ā€œI love him like a son and it means a great deal to me, personally, knowing he’ll be here for several years.ā€

With a touch of humor, Dickerson addressed the emotional impact of the announcement.

ā€œI expect this announcement could test the effectiveness of my blood pressure medication, so I’ve alerted my physician he may have to adjust the dosage appropriately but, it’ll be worth it.ā€

Teammates and Team Environment

This season, Hocevar will continue alongside Michael McDowell, now entering his second year with Spire Motorsports, and Daniel Suarez, a new addition to the team. Remaining with Spire also provides Hocevar opportunities to compete in other series, including the team’s truck series entry and dirt late model racing.

Hocevar commented on the strong camaraderie within the team and his excitement about the future.

ā€œThis shows we’re all committed and eager to race with each other for a long time,ā€

said Hocevar.

ā€œEveryone in the building has really become a family to me. Spire is such a different team now compared to how it was my rookie season, and especially when I made my debut in 2023. It’s fun to know I’m going to be around the Cup garage for a long time, and really a dream come true.ā€

Hocevar’s Journey in Motorsport

Carson Hocevar’s NASCAR Cup Series debut came in 2023 at World Wide Technology Raceway when he was just 20 years old. Prior to that, his impressive Truck Series career featured solid performances that made him one of the sport’s promising young talents.
